The Ultimate Climbing Gym offers expansive, well-set routes and inviting bouldering walls for climbers of all levels. Located at 6904 Downwind Rd Rear Entrance in Greensboro, the cavernous facility features friendly, knowledgeable staff, belay training, and classes for all ages. Access to 40-foot top-rope and lead climbing walls with varied routes for all skill levels.
Extensive bouldering walls with challenging problems set by experienced route setters.
Professional instruction for safe belaying techniques, suitable for beginners and groups.
Rental of harnesses, shoes, and other essential equipment for a complete climbing experience.
Customized climbing lessons for all ages, from kids to adults, led by knowledgeable staff.
Flexible visit options with punch cards for frequent climbers and casual visitors.
